[0033] Referring to Figure 2, the basic elements included in the inventive concept are the two memories responsible for storing event data: the main memory 204 and the secondary memory 206, and the control entity 202, which actually performs the processes required to update and provide event frequency related information . The memories 204, 206 and the control entity 202 may comprise devices connected to each other functionally in the same physical device 201 or divided into several devices. Abstract

A memory efficient method and an electronic device for counting frequencies of various events. The structure for storing frequency data comprises primary (204) and secondary (206) storages which contain the frequency data (208, 210, 214) in different levels of detail. The primary storage (204) is a detailed storage comprising both event type and count information units in a fully restorable form.The secondary storage (206) is targeted for more infrequent events with lower level of detail and constructed as an array of count values addressed by a hash function using event type as an input. Another option is to derive a shortened ID from the event type by utilizing a hash function and exploit the ID as an addressing key for the corresponding count. Events are moved between the primary (204) and secondary (206) storages depending on the detected event type frequencies. The invention is utilized in a recommendation engine for grading and sorting bookmarks stored in browsers for accessingthe Internet.
